日韩小视频-日韩久久一区二区三区-日韩久久一级毛片-日韩久久久精品中文字幕-国产精品亚洲精品影院-国产精品亚洲欧美云霸高清

下載吧 - 綠色安全的游戲和軟件下載中心

軟件下載吧

當前位置:軟件下載吧 > 數據庫 > DB2 > MongoDB實現“SQL NoSQL”合一(mongodb支持sql)

MongoDB實現“SQL NoSQL”合一(mongodb支持sql)

時間:2024-03-12 20:33作者:下載吧人氣:24

MongoDB是一種面向文檔的數據庫,它旨在替換關系型數據庫的傳統用法,并為Web應用提供軟件包,以形成一體化的解決方案。在過去的幾年里,MongoDB的受歡迎程度已經大大增加,特別是在NoSQL社區中。這也激發了“SQL NoSQL”seamless convergence –將強大的MongoDB技術與靈活的SQL語言相結合,實現多數據源支持,并且以最佳方式執行每種操作。

例如,MongoDB在支持SQL語句時無需使用模式,可以實現高度靈活性,從而允許使用SQL查詢組合復雜的文檔對象。以下是一個使用MongoDB實現“SQL NoSQL”合一的示例代碼:

//Step 1: 創建一個MongoDB數據庫 
// 使用mongo shell來創建一個MongoDB數據庫
use myDb
//Step 2: 插入文檔
// 使用字典對象或文檔對象插入文檔
db.people.insertMany([
{name:"John", age:30, hobbies:["cycling","reading"],pets:[{name:"Fido",type:"dog"}]},
{name:"Jane", age:22, hobbies:["running","swimming"],pets:[{name:"Stripe",type:"cat"}]}
])
//Step 3: 執行SQL查詢
// 使用aggregation pipeline與SQL查詢結合
db.people.aggregate([
{$match:{name:"John"}},
{$unwind:"$pets"},
{$project:{name:1, petName:"$pets.name"}}
])

通過上面的代碼,我們看到MongoDB如何實現SQL封裝合一,很顯然,我們可以在MongoDB中可以輕松地通過SQL查詢跟蹤和操作非常復雜的文檔對象。此外,MongoDB還支持用戶自定義函數,使用這個特性可以實現更多的數據處理方法。

最后,MongoDB在融合SQL語言與NoSQL社區方面還做了許多改進,使得用戶可以以最佳方式使用數據庫。它不僅支持靈活的文檔對象,還能實現數據源之間的無縫集成,實現“SQL NoSQL”完美融合。

標簽mongodb支持sql,MongoDB,SQL,MongoDB,使用,實現,文檔,name

相關下載

查看所有評論+

網友評論

網友
您的評論需要經過審核才能顯示

熱門閱覽

最新排行

公眾號

主站蜘蛛池模板: 久久影院在线观看 | 国产一级一级 | 亚欧成人 | 永久在线 | 午夜美女影院 | 欧美一级毛片大片免费播放 | 国产精品免费视频一区 | 久草精彩视频 | 久久久久国产精品免费 | 中国一级性生活片 | 欧美成人中文字幕 | 国产三级a三级三级三级 | 成人做爰全过程免费看网站 | 亚洲最大情网站在线观看 | 91香蕉成人免费网站 | 国产三级小视频 | 中国美女一级片 | 69中国xxxxxxxx18 | 国产亚洲免费观看 | 国产三级国产精品国产国在线观看 | 亚洲国产精品一区二区三区久久 | 亚洲欧美日韩国产综合高清 | 欧洲精品一区二区三区在线观看 | 国产在线一区观看 | 国产高清一区二区三区视频 | 高清精品一区二区三区一区 | 91天堂网 | 欧美 日韩 国产 在线 | 国产精品资源手机在线播放 | 成人免费观看www在线 | 亚洲自拍高清 | 情侣偷偷看的羞羞视频网站 | a级日韩乱理伦片在线观看 a级特黄毛片免费观看 | 欧美精品一区视频 | 欧美极品欧美精品欧美视频 | 亚洲www在线| 欧美成人精品一级高清片 | 亚洲孕交 | 欧美在线 | 亚洲 | 国产精品毛片久久久久久久 | 波野多结衣在线观看 |